Auto merge of #113476 - fee1-dead-contrib:c-str-lit, r=petrochenkov
Reimplement C-str literals This reverts #113334, cc `@fmease.` While converting lexer tokens to ast Tokens in `rustc_parse`, we check the edition of the span of the token. If the edition < 2021, we split the token into two, one being the identifier and other being the str literal.
